Put your skills and training to use to perform IT functions and support to our staff Apply today to join our IT Team DESCRIPTION OF WORK This position provides support and systems enhancement activities for Information Technology (IT) end users for Bedford-Somerset Developmental and Behavioral Health Services (DBHS). Requires and provides excellent customer service, establishing and maintaining a good working relationship with staff, contracted providers, service providers, and the general public. Work is performed independently using initiative and judgment to resolve user technical problems in the use of IT. Performs all aspects of employee workstations and peripheral support to include installation, maintenance, and upgrades for PC software. Provides support for telecommunication equipment and services, to include VoIP functions, audio and video conference equipment, and web conferencing. Performs software diagnostic procedures including software utility programs to assess and troubleshoot information technology software problems. Assists with software support functions to all field-based personnel. Support includes responsibility for cellular and broadband internet connections, VPN connections, printers/multifunction devices, workstations, laptops, and tablets. Assists with coding and documenting revisions and modification processes to support application software. Assists in developing reporting information and analytics for staff applications. Assists with ensuring and/or providing day-to-day user support for approximately 250 workstations. Supports VPN connectivity for remote users. This position: Assumes primary support for all printers. Assists with IT inventories and tagging all IT equipment with inventory asset tags, scanning and inventorying items. Documents and manages work assignments through the Help Desk Request System. Assists with implementation and provides end user support and training for all upcoming IT initiatives. Conducts formal classroom and informal information technology training as needed. Develops forms, assists and/or provides training on how to develop forms for the Electronic Health Record, HR Software, Fiscal Software and others as needed. Develops training materials, manuals, bulletins, on-line help documents, and other user aids. Maintains a safe work area and promotes an accident-free workplace for others by ensuring equipment and cables do not pose hazards. Performs other related duties as assigned.
